In the fifth episode of The Justice Brief, journalist Saurav Das explores the recent surge of bail orders issued by the Supreme Court of India, particularly for high-profile opposition leaders like Manish Sisodia and K Kavitha. Das highlights how the court has diluted some of the harsh provisions of the PMLA and UAPA, raising questions about the government’s ability to keep these leaders incarcerated. He also examines the critical role played by the bench of Justice BR Gavai, which has criticised the selective actions of government agencies like the ED and reiterated the legal principle that "bail is the rule, jail is the exception." More importantly, this episode examines whether these progressive principles are being followed in other cases, especially in lower courts, which often shy away from granting bail.
